This legislation, known as the Data BRIDGE Act , mandates that the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) enhance its existing National Broadband Map. Within 180 days of the bill's enactment, the FCC is required to integrate a new data layer specifically identifying the location of agricultural areas across the United States. To ensure accuracy and comprehensive data integration, the Commission must engage in consultations with several key entities. These include the Secretary of Agriculture , the Assistant Secretary of Commerce for Communications and Information, representatives from various States, and other relevant stakeholders as deemed appropriate by the FCC.
